How to Increase GLP-1 Hormone Levels Naturally
“How can I support my body’s ability to make more GLP-1?” is a question we hear often in our clinic.
With the surge of use of GLP-1 medications in recent years, patients have become very familiar with the power of this peptide to facilitate weight loss. Glucagon-like-peptide-1 is made in our bodies primarily by specialized enteroendocrine L-cells located in the lining of our gut.
Research has exploded on the many effects of GLP-1 on our bodies and how this peptide facilitates weight loss. Below we will explain of how GLP-1 is produced in the intestines and how you can support healthy levels naturally.
Here are the six areas of endogenous GLP-1 production in your digestive tract and tips how to increase levels:
1. Intestinal epithelial cells can sense the concentration of glucose in the gut lumen and initiate the secretion of GLP-1 when the concentration reaches a certain level.
How you can help this
Ensure that your “gut lining” is healthy so your epithelial cells can respond appropriately. There are lots of considerations in having a healthy gut lining including eating a generally low inflammatory diet and avoiding food sensitivities unique to you. Ensure a diet rich in a gut healing amino acid called L-glutamine is also important.
2. Dietary fibres are fermented to SCFAs (*short chain fatty acids) by gut microbiota, which bind to GPR43 receptors, then promote the production of GLP-1.
You can...
Support microbial diversity with prebiotics such as polyphenols in colourful fruits and vegetables, arabinogalactan, prebiotics in our diet like soluble fibres and fermented foods
Common therapeutic supplementation to support the health of the epithelial cells lining our gut include L-glutamine, prebiotics such as arabinogalactan, prebiotics in our diet like soluble fibres and fermented foods. See the image below of foods to rotate to promote a diversified microbiome through diet.

3. Secondary bile acids bind to TGR5 and promote the production of GLP-1.
Primary Bile acids are transported from the liver to the intestinal lumen, metabolized by gut microbiota, and finally are transformed into secondary bile acids.
You can...
Support a diversified microbiome with a diversity of soluble fibre foods as suggested above. (SCFAs feed the healthy microbes) (Note that if you don’t have a gallbladder, you might benefit from some supplementation of ox bile.)

4. 2-OG (glycerol) bind to GLPR119 receptor of L cells(specialized enteroendocrine cells in the gut epithelium( to promote the production of GLP-1. Dietary fats are digested into 2-OG (2-oleoyl glycerol) and fatty acids under the action of the intestinal bacteria.
Tip
Eat healthy fats and include coconut oil as great source of glycerol.
5. LPS (lipopolysaccharide) on the surface of Gram-negative bacteria can bind to TLR4 receptor of L cells and then promote the production of GLP-1 production.
Note
While we don’t want to drive LPS production too much and create inflammation, supporting it with a gram negative bacteria like akkermansia can be helpful.
6. Tryptophan is a digestive biproduct/amino acid of dietary protein and is then further broken down in to indole. Indole promotes the production of GLP-1.
Help by..
Including clean protein sources into each meal. Lean poultry, meat, nuts and seeds.
